Seoul
Seoul, the vibrant capital of South Korea, is a pulsating hub of culture and commerce. Explore the iconic Gyeongbokgung Palace, the largest of the Five Grand Palaces, and immerse yourself in the grandeur of Joseon-era architecture. Visit the Lotte World Tower, the tallest skyscraper in South Korea, for panoramic city views that stretch for miles. And don't miss the bustling streets of Myeongdong, a shopper's paradise brimming with countless boutiques and department stores.
Jeju Island
Escape to the breathtakingly idyllic paradise of Jeju Island. Designated as a UNESCO World Heritage site, this volcanic island boasts pristine beaches, stunning waterfalls, and enigmatic lava tubes. Ascend Mount Hallasan, the highest peak in South Korea, for breathtaking panoramic vistas. Explore the unique Manjanggul Lava Tube, a subterranean wonder that transports you to a world of ethereal beauty. And relax in the volcanic hot springs, renowned for their therapeutic properties.
Busan
Discover the vibrant coastal city of Busan, South Korea's second-largest metropolis. Stroll along the picturesque Haeundae Beach, the country's most popular summer destination. Visit the Busan Tower for panoramic city and ocean views. And explore the bustling Jagalchi Fish Market, one of the largest and most vibrant seafood markets in the world.
Gyeongju
Step back in time to the ancient city of Gyeongju, the former capital of the Silla Kingdom. Explore the UNESCO World Heritage-listed Bulguksa Temple, a masterpiece of Buddhist architecture. Visit the Seokguram Grotto, an artificial cave adorned with exquisite carvings. And wander through the Tumuli Park, where hundreds of royal tombs from the Silla period lie hidden beneath verdant hills.
Suwon
Immerse yourself in the rich history and culture of Suwon, located just an hour south of Seoul. Visit the UNESCO World Heritage-listed Hwaseong Fortress, a massive 18th-century fortification that still stands intact today. Explore the Suwon Hwaseong Museum to learn about the fortress's construction and significance. And visit the Korean Folk Village to experience traditional Korean life, culture, and architecture.

Yeosu
Experience the beauty and wonder of Yeosu, a coastal city renowned for its stunning natural landscapes. Visit the Yeosu Expo 2012 site, a vibrant waterfront complex that showcases the latest in green technology and sustainable living. Explore Odongdo Island, a picturesque island with stunning rock formations, pristine beaches, and a historic lighthouse. And take a boat trip to the nearby Dadohae National Marine Park, home to a diverse range of marine life.
Sokcho
Venturing to the eastern coast, discover the charming city of Sokcho, the gateway to Seoraksan National Park. Explore the Sokcho Expo Tower for panoramic views of the city and coastline. Visit the Abai Village, a traditional Korean fishing village that has been preserved as a living museum. And ascend Seoraksan National Park's breathtaking peaks for unforgettable hiking trails and stunning mountain vistas.
Chuncheon
Nestled in the scenic Gangwon Province, Chuncheon is a city known for its natural beauty and culinary delights. Explore the scenic Nami Island, a popular filming location for Korean dramas, and marvel at its serene beauty. Visit the Chuncheon Myeongdong Street, a bustling shopping street lined with restaurants, shops, and street vendors. And indulge in the city's signature dish, dakgalbi, a spicy stir-fried chicken dish that is sure to tantalize your taste buds.
